Crime overview

Tontine Street area has the 8th highest crime rate of 24 local areas in Folkestone Central , and the 12th highest crime rate of 348 local areas in Folkestone and Hythe .

Crime levels at this postcode are much higher than in the adjoining streets, suggesting that most neighbouring areas are relatively safer than this one.

The overall crime rate in the area around Tontine Street (CT20 1JP) in the last 12 months was 377.2 per 1,000 residents and was 64.7% higher than the Folkestone Central average (229.1 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 86 offences recorded. The least common crime was Bicycle theft with 1 case , unchanged from 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Other crime ( 66.7% YoY). The sharpest decline was Anti-social behaviour ( -26.2%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 94 (≈ 206.1 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were rising ( 13.3%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-83.4%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around Tontine Street (CT20 1JP), the main crime hotspot is near Marine Terrace. Police recorded 146 crimes here, including 64 violent or public-order offences. All these locations are within roughly 0.3 miles.
